Q: Is 403,655 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 403,655 is not a prime number.

Why is 403,655 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 403655 can be evenly divided by 1 5 7 19 35 95 133 607 665 3,035 4,249 11,533 21,245 57,665 80,731 and 403,655, with no remainder.

Since 403,655 cannot be divided by just 1 and 403,655, it is not a prime number.
